Stampin Up … pstg education nationaleWebMixing up the sequence of letters This is most often seen in spelling. The child may know how to spell the word but the information is output from the brain in the wrong sequence. Typical errors: ‘dose’ for ‘does’ ‘hlep’ for ‘help’ Omitting letters when spelling is also common. 4.
